Knaster–Kuratowski–Mazurkiewicz lemma
The Knaster–Kuratowski–Mazurkiewicz lemma is a basic result in mathematical fixed-point theory published in 1929 by Knaster, Kuratowski and Mazurkiewicz.
The KKM lemma can be proved from Sperner's lemma and can be used to prove the Brouwer fixed-point theorem.
